Random Data Receipt Printer Driver Software V7.17 May 2026
Configurable for USB, Ethernet, Serial, and Virtual COM port connections. Hardware Control: Enables specific printer functions such as automatic paper cutting cash drawer kick Print Configuration:
: The installer is typically around 2.6 MB and is often named POS Printer Driver Setup V7.17.exe . Installation Steps Random Data Receipt Printer Driver Software V7.17
Windows (XP through Windows 11), Android, iOS, Mac, and Linux. Primary Application: Configurable for USB, Ethernet, Serial, and Virtual COM
Security researchers use the Random Data Driver to perform "fuzzing" attacks on printer firmware. Sending random data may reveal buffer overflow vulnerabilities or unhandled exceptions in the printer’s onboard software. Since this is a generic driver used by
: Triggering the mechanical cutter once a receipt is finished.
Since this is a generic driver used by multiple manufacturers, you can find the V7.17 setup file on several official support pages:
| Error Message | Probable Cause | Solution | | :--- | :--- | :--- | | “Driver failed to start” | Windows Defender or antivirus blocking *.sys file. | Add RDRandom.sys to antivirus exclusion list. | | “Printer prints garbage then stops” | Baud rate mismatch on serial connection. | Open Device Manager → COM Port Properties → Set baud to 9600 or 19200 to match printer DIP switches. | | “Random data is not random (repeating patterns)” | Pseudo-random generator seed failure. | Reboot the host PC to reinitialize the entropy source. | | “Driver conflicts with standard POS driver” | Two drivers claiming the same printer endpoint. | Uninstall the standard driver (e.g., Epson Advanced) before using V7.17. | | “Paper out error despite paper being loaded” | V7.17 not receiving paper sensor status. | Check that the printer’s “Paper End” sensor is wired correctly (particularly on parallel ports). |